Why Indie Games Are Shaping the Future of Mobile Gaming

Published: 2026-08-10 00:43:07 Views:

Introduction

Indie games are more than just a trend; they are shaping the very fabric of the mobile gaming industry. As developers push the boundaries of creativity and innovation, we see unique gameplay experiences that resonate with players on a deeper level. In this article, we will explore how indie games are influencing the future of mobile gaming.

1. Innovation and Creativity

One of the defining characteristics of indie games is their commitment to innovation. Unlike larger studios that often play it safe with franchises, indie developers have the freedom to experiment with new ideas and mechanics. Titles like Journey and Florence prove that storytelling and emotional depth can be as compelling as action-focused gameplay.

2. Diverse Genres and Styles

Indie games offer a broad spectrum of genres and artistic styles, allowing players to experience everything from narrative-driven adventures to quirky puzzle games. The sheer variety ensures that every player can find something that resonates with their tastes.

3. Accessible Gaming

Many indie games are designed with accessibility in mind, ensuring that a wider audience can enjoy gaming regardless of skill level. Titles like Stardew Valley and Celeste allow players to engage at their own pace, promoting inclusivity in gaming.

4. Community Engagement

Indie developers often foster close-knit communities around their games. Players feel more connected to the creators, leading to an engaged fanbase that can influence future updates and expansions. This sense of shared ownership enhances player loyalty.

5. Challenging the Status Quo

Indie games challenge traditional gaming norms, offering narratives and gameplay experiences that larger studios might overlook. This approach leads to more authentic representations of diverse experiences, encouraging conversations around topics often neglected in mainstream gaming.

6. Future Trends

As technology advances, we can expect to see more innovation from indie developers. With the rise of AR and VR, indie games are likely to explore new dimensions of gameplay, further enhancing the mobile gaming experience.

Conclusion

The impact of indie games on mobile gaming is profound and far-reaching. By championing creativity, accessibility, and community engagement, indie developers are not just shaping trends; they are paving the way for a more inclusive and innovative future in gaming. As players, embracing and supporting these indie titles is essential for the continued evolution of the industry.
